The Test Architect is a key position, responsible for defining and implementing advanced testing strategies across the software development lifecycle. This role goes beyond traditional testing by incorporating software development skills to automate tests, develop tools, and enhance the overall quality of code from the initial stages of development through to deployment. The Test Architect will lead the effort in building robust, scalable, and efficient testing frameworks, ensuring the integration of automated testing within the CI/CD pipeline, and driving the adoption of best practices in test automation.
**Key Responsibilities**:
- **Strategic Test Planning**: Develop and refine the testing strategy to include modern testing methodologies and practices, ensuring comprehensive coverage across unit, integration, system, acceptance, performance, security, and UI testing.
- **Automation Framework Development**: Design and build scalable and maintainable test automation frameworks that support automated testing efforts across multiple platforms (web, mobile, API).
- **Performance and Security Testing Expertise**: Lead efforts in non-functional testing areas by developing and executing performance test scripts and security test plans, utilizing specialized tools to benchmark and identify vulnerabilities.
- **Continuous Integration/Continuous Deployment (CI/CD)**: Integrate automated tests into CI/CD pipelines, ensuring that testing is an integral part of the build and deployment processes. Monitor and optimize pipeline performance to facilitate rapid, reliable releases.
- **Tool and Technology Evaluation**: Continuously research and evaluate new testing tools, technologies, and practices to enhance the effectiveness and efficiency of testing. Advocate for the adoption of tools that offer significant benefits.
- **Mentorship and Leadership**: Mentor QA engineers and developers in test automation practices, code quality standards, and cutting-edge testing technologies. Foster a culture of quality and continuous improvement within the team.
